

Krista Escamilla
Anchor/Reporter
Krista Escamilla is an Associated Press Award winning journalist for her spot coverage of two major West Texas news stories, the search for Little Destiny and the Alon Refinery Explosion. In 2010, Krista was recognized for fair and balanced reporting by the Midland Independent School District and honored by the state of Texas as a member of the Media Honor Roll. She is also involved with various organizations serving as emcee for Odessa Links, Midland Police Department, Bynum School and the Permian Basin Rehabilitation Center.
Since graduating from California State University of Sacramento, Krista worked in television news in Sacramento, Tampa and St. Joseph, Missouri. She began anchoring the morning/noon news for CBS7 in 2006. "I like morning news because it gives me a chance to share the latest news that will impact your day and have fun at the same time. The hours are tough but it gives me more "mom time" with my FOUR kids when I get off work." She feels privileged to be working at CBS7 among such talented and kindhearted people, plus Greg Morgan makes her laugh.
Krista grew up in the entertainment world as a singer, dancer and model. Some of her works include Esprit Modeling, Elyce designs, Cellular One and Maers T.V. Krista's dream to compete in the Miss America Scholarship Pageant came true when she won the Miss Napa County and Miss San Francisco titles, allowing her to pay for her college through scholarship money. Her experience on stage continued as a professional performer as the dancer/lead acrobat for the San Francisco Opera and lead singer/dancer at Six Flags Amusement Park. Krista graduated with an Associate of Arts degree in Dramatic Arts and a Bachelor of Arts degree in Broadcast Communication. Krista followed her passion for news and moved to the Midland/Odessa area in 1998 where she met her husband. As a mother of four, Krista devotes her spare time to her children but loves an occasional session of yoga, running and golf.
